Digital image compression employing a resolution gradient

TL;DR: In this article, a log polar mapper was used to match the image display to human perceptual resolution to achieve a 25:1 compression ratio with no loss of perceived cues, and then the perceptual channels were separated into low resolution, high discrimination level color and high resolution, low discrimination level contrast edges.

HelpMate autonomous mobile robot navigation system

TL;DR: In this paper, a mobile robotic materials transport system that performs fetch and carry tasks at Danbury Hospital is described, which can autonomously navigate along the main arteries of the hospital crossing between buildings via interconnecting hallways and uses radio to communicate with the elevator.
